How Robitussin Mucus Cough Congestion Relief works
This formula contains two active ingredients:

  • Guaifenesin – an expectorant that helps turn an unproductive cough into a more effective, less frequent cough

  • Pseudoephedrine hydrochloride – a nasal decongestant that relieves congestion caused by colds

Directions
Always take Robitussin Mucus Cough Congestion Relief exactly as described in the patient information leaflet or as directed by your doctor or Happy Pharmacy pharmacist.
Take 10ml every 4–6 hours, up to 4 times per day. Do not exceed the recommended dose. ⏱️

Side effects
Some people may experience side effects, although not everyone will. Common side effects include:

  • Nausea, vomiting, or sickness 

  • Headaches

  • Dizziness

  • Restlessness or anxiety

  • Insomnia 

  • Skin rashes

  • Increased blood pressure

  • Tremors

If you experience any side effects, including those not listed in the leaflet, report them via the MHRA Yellow Card Scheme.

Serious side effects
Seek emergency medical attention if you notice:

  • Swelling of the face or throat

  • Rash or itching

  • Breathing difficulties

  • Loss of consciousness 

Warnings
Do not take this product if you:

  • Are allergic to any of the ingredients

  • Have uncontrolled high blood pressure

  • Have kidney disease or failure

  • Have heart disease

  • Have an overactive thyroid

  • Have glaucoma, diabetes, or an enlarged prostate

  • Have pheochromocytoma

  • Have difficulty passing urine

Speak to your GP or pharmacist before use if you:

  • Have hyperthyroidism

  • Have a chronic cough, asthma, bronchitis or emphysema

  • Have a history of psychosis or prostate problems

Using/taking other medicines
Do not take if you’re currently using:

  • MAOIs (monoamine oxidase inhibitors)

  • Blood pressure medication (e.g. alpha or beta blockers)

  • Other decongestants

  • Certain antibiotics (e.g. oxazolidinones)

  • Ergotamine or methysergide for migraines

Age restrictions
This product is not suitable for children under 12
